The House Edge
One of the most important concepts in casino games is the house edge. This mathematical advantage ensures that the casino always has an edge over the players in the long run. It is like a small fee charged by the casino for providing the games and entertainment. While the house edge varies from game to game, it is crucial to be aware of it when choosing which games to play. Slot Machines: The Luck of the Spins
Slot machines are a staple in any casino, and they are known for their enticing jackpots and flashing lights. However, behind the spinning reels lies a complex algorithm that determines the outcome of each spin. Slot machines operate using a Random Number Generator (RNG), which generates thousands of random numbers per second. These numbers correspond to the position of each reel, determining the winning combinations. While there are no strategies to guarantee a win, understanding the RNG and payback percentages can increase your chances of hitting the jackpot.
Blackjack: Beat the Dealer
Blackjack is a popular card game where players aim to beat the dealer’s hand without going over 21. Unlike other casino games, blackjack involves an element of skill in addition to luck. By following a basic strategy, players can significantly reduce the house edge and increase their odds of winning. Basic strategy charts provide players with the optimal move for each possible hand combination, taking into account the player’s hand and the dealer’s upcard.
Roulette: The Wheel of Fortune
Roulette is a game of chance that has captivated casino-goers for centuries. The game revolves around a spinning wheel with numbered compartments and a small ball. Players place their bets on the outcome of the ball landing in a particular compartment. The odds in roulette can be calculated based on the number of compartments and the type of bet placed. Understanding the different bet types and their corresponding odds can help you make informed decisions and potentially win big.
Poker: Skill Meets Probability
Unlike other casino games where you play against the house, poker is a game of skill where players compete against each other. While luck plays a role in determining the cards dealt, it is the players’ knowledge of probabilities, psychology, and strategy that ultimately determines the winner. Understanding the odds of getting certain hands, knowing when to fold, and reading your opponents’ behavior are crucial skills in this game of skill and chance.
